Understanding the Sump Pump


Before diving right into the cleansing procedure, it's essential to have a fundamental understanding of exactly how a sump pump works. Generally mounted in a pit or container below the basement floor, a sump pump consists of numerous vital elements, consisting of a pump, a float button, and a discharge pipe. When water collects in the pit, the float switch activates the pump, which then pumps the water out with the discharge pipe, away from the building's structure.

Planning for Cleaning


Before you start cleansing your sump pump, it's vital to take some security preventative measures. Beginning by shutting down the power to the pump to avoid any electrical mishaps. In addition, put on appropriate protective equipment, such as gloves and safety glasses, to safeguard yourself from dirt, debris, and possible virus.

Step-by-step Overview to Cleaning a Sump Pump


Shutting Off the Power


Begin by detaching the power supply to the sump pump to avoid any type of accidents while cleaning.

Removing Debris and Dirt


Make use of a pail or an inside story to eliminate any visible debris, dirt, or sediment from the sump pit. Dispose of the debris effectively to prevent it from blocking the pump or the discharge pipeline.

Cleaning up the Pump and Drift Switch Over


Once the pit is clear of particles, very carefully remove the pump from the pit. Check the pump and the float button for any type of indications of damages or wear. Utilize a soft brush or fabric to cleanse the surface areas and eliminate any kind of gathered grime.

Purging the System


After cleaning up the pump and float button, purge the sump pit with clean water to get rid of any kind of staying dust or debris. This will help make sure that the pump operates smoothly and efficiently.

Checking for Appropriate Performance


Prior to reinstalling the pump, execute a quick test to guarantee that the float switch activates the pump correctly. Put some water into the sump pit and observe the pump's procedure. If whatever is working properly, you can reconstruct the pump and reconnect the power supply.

    How To Inspect And Clean A Sump Pump


    There are a few things you may want to look for when inspecting your sump pump. These include:



  • Leaks: If you notice any leaks around the sump pump, it likely needs to be repaired or replaced.


  • Mud or Water: If there is any mud or water around the sump pump, it’s likely that it’s not working properly and needs to be cleaned.


  • Noises: If you hear any strange noises coming from the sump pump, it may be indicative of a problem.


  • Next, you’ll need to clean the sump pump. If you notice any of these issues, it’s best to clean the sump pump as soon as possible. To do this, you’ll need to remove the pump from its housing. Be sure to have a bucket handy to catch any water that may spill out. Once the pump is removed, use a brush or a spray nozzle to clean off all of the mud and debris. You may also want to check the impeller for damage or wear and tear. If you find any damage, you’ll need to replace the pump.



    Once the pump is clean, reattach it to its housing and replace any parts that were removed. Be sure to test the pump before putting everything back in place. Once everything is back in order, put the cover back on the sump pit and refill it with water.
